About North-South Lake

North-South Lake is not a lakefront-living market, and this guide says so up front. The lake — two shallow basins in the Catskill Forest Preserve — is DEC public land run as North-South Lake Campground: 219 sites across seven loops, two lifeguarded beaches, a non-motorized boat concession. No marina, no camps-and-estates ring, no restaurant with its name on the water. What it has instead is proximity — the closest true mountain-lake experience to New York City, a two-and-a-half to three-hour drive, making it a weekend-carload destination the way the Adirondacks serve Boston. The identity is hiking, not boating — Sunset Rock and Boulder Rock deliver the Hudson River School views that predate the Catskill Mountain House (1823–1963, gateposts only remain). Kaaterskill Falls, one of New York's tallest waterfalls, sits a mile beyond — genuinely dangerous off-trail, worth taking seriously rather than treating as a photo op. Down the mountain, Tannersville and Hunter carry the restaurants, coffee, breweries, and the actual short-term rental inventory this platform connects to — ten to fifteen minutes from the campground gate. Come for the trailheads and the drive-up convenience; stay in town for dinner.
